For a while, it was believed that teenagers took more risks because they just really didn’t understand, they weren’t able to really apprehend the risks, or to believe that they applied to them. However, research in the lab had been unable to detect differences between adolescents and adults when sitting them down and asking them questions like, ‘how dangerous is it to drive above the speed limit?’ In that kind of situation, adolescents provide answers that are very similar to adults, so that doesn’t help us understand why it is that, in the real world, adolescents do engage in risky behaviours at a higher rate than adults.
There are two parallel tracks of development happening in the brain across adolescence that are relevant for understanding increased risk-taking in adolescence. On the one hand, across this period, you have a gradual, steady increase in the ability to control your impulses and in functions related to that like regulating emotions and planning ahead.
On the other hand, we have this other neurological network that is responsive to reward. That reward could be social approval, which is particularly important in adolescence. The network that responds to potential reward gets really excitable in early adolescence right around the time of the onset of puberty and it increases in strength rapidly, so it’s outpacing the development of impulse control. So, they’re going to go for that exciting activity even if there’s a little risk involved especially in the presence of their friends. They lack the mature level of impulse control that might put the brakes on that.
We know it does not work to reason with them about it because in the moment, when they’re excited, all of that goes out the window. What works is reducing the opportunity to engage in the risk-taking behaviour.
